Abraham Sewill contributed to the Chia-Network/chia-blockchain and chia-docs repositories, focusing on code refinement and documentation quality. In the blockchain project, he improved user experience by clarifying a user-facing error message in the Wallet RPC API, addressing a grammatical issue without altering functional logic. This change enhanced maintainability and reduced confusion for both users and developers. In the documentation repository, Abraham consolidated and clarified interoperability standards for the Chia Gaming Ecosystem, removing duplication and correcting language to support partner onboarding. His work demonstrated attention to detail in Python, Markdown, and technical writing, with a focus on maintainability and clear communication.
